Job description

Overview

Our client is a well-established international manufacturer specializing in highly engineered industrial equipment for customers throughout North America. They design and deliver intricate, tailor-made capital projects to industrial, infrastructure, and manufacturing sectors. Due to ongoing expansion, they are looking to hire an experienced Director of Projects to lead their project execution division based in Alpharetta, GA.

Role Summary

This senior leadership role is accountable for managing the successful delivery of complex engineered-to-order projects from contract award through commissioning and final project closeout. The Director will oversee a team of Project Managers and work closely with departments including Engineering, Manufacturing, Supply Chain, Finance, and Sales to ensure projects meet safety standards, timelines, budget constraints, and profitability goals.

Primary Responsibilities

  • Lead and mentor a team of Project Managers handling major capital equipment projects.
  • Ensure consistent execution across all project aspects including scope, schedule, cost, quality, and customer satisfaction.
  • Manage relationships with vendors, suppliers, and external contracted resources.
  • Supervise site services and installation teams supporting project delivery.
  • Act as the escalation point for significant customer and project issues at the executive level.
  • Collaborate with Finance to oversee project profitability, cash flow, forecasting, and manage change orders.
  • Enhance project management methodologies, reporting systems, governance, and key performance indicators.
  • Coordinate with Engineering, Manufacturing, and Sales departments throughout the entire project lifecycle.
  • Promote a culture centered on accountability, effective communication, ongoing improvement, and execution excellence.

Qualifications

  • Bachelor's degree in Engineering, Construction Management, Business, or a related discipline.
  • At least 10 years of experience leading engineered-to-order, industrial manufacturing, or capital equipment projects.
  • Demonstrated success in managing and developing high-performing project management teams.
  • Strong expertise in contract administration, risk mitigation, project controls, and change order management.
  • Experience operating within complex manufacturing or heavy industrial environments.
  • Exceptional communication skills at the executive level and capability to maintain strong customer relationships.
